## Sort Stability Limits

The Rookline report builder guarantees stable sort only up to a fixed row count; beyond it, the engine switches to an unstable external sort for memory reasons. Ties past the threshold may reorder between runs. New folks: always add a unique tiebreaker column if determinism matters. Row thresholds, memory caps, and the spill cutoff are quota-enforced and cannot be raised per report. Current values are defined below.

tuning table, yajog-yahof:
BUDGETS = {
    "lamvan": 303,
    "wenox": 460,
    "fenvan": 525,
}

Pricing review: Vexlan Series margins slipped 3 points this quarter after the Torbridge discounting push. List prices hold; discretionary discounts capped at 12% effective next month. Mid-tier SKUs carry the line — protect them. Enterprise tier repriced upward 6%; expect pushback, hold firm. Full model is with the finance office. The strategic context for these changes is summarized below.

confidential, bahof-yaweg: Headcount on the Kaseth team goes from 32 to 109 by the end of January. Gross margin on Kaseth came in at 46 percent against a plan of 45 percent.

## Authentication

The Plexa profile store is sharded across twelve partitions, and every shard router expects authenticated requests — there is no anonymous read path, even in development. Each service talking to Plexa uses its own credential issued by the Keymast control plane; do not borrow another team's. Credentials are scoped per environment, so a staging key will be rejected by production routers with a 403, not a 401, which trips people up. For local development against the shared staging cluster, authenticate with the key below.

gateway credential: qvz7-vWy80ME

## BounceSift — Environment Variables

BounceSift parses DSN reports from the Merlix mail relay and flags hard bounces. Set BOUNCE_POLL_INTERVAL (seconds) and BOUNCE_BATCH_MAX before startup. Soft bounces retry three times; tune with BOUNCE_RETRY_CAP. All vars live in /etc/bouncesift/env. The relay requires an auth token on every poll, so add the following line to the env file.

vault entry, yahif-yajep: COURIER_KEY29=b802bdf8034096b65a51c6ba5abe2